Original Arabic
حَدَّثَنَا إِسْحَاقُ بْنُ عِيسَى، أَخْبَرَنِي مَالِكٌ، عَنْ سُمَيٍّ، عَنْ أَبِي صَالِحٍ، عَنْ أَبِي هُرَيْرَةَ، قَالَ: قَالَ رَسُولُ اللهِ صَلَّى الله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: " مَنْ قَالَ: لَا إِلَهَ إِلَّا اللهُ، وَحْدَهُ لَا شَرِيكَ لَهُ، لَهُ الْمُلْكُ وَلَهُ الْحَمْدُ وَهُوَ عَلَى كُلِّ شَيْءٍ قَدِيرٌ فِي يَوْمٍ (٢) مِائَةَ مَرَّةٍ، كَانَتْ لَهُ عَدْلَ عَشْرِ رِقَابٍ، وَكُتِبَتْ لَهُ مِائَةُ حَسَنَةٍ، وَمُحِيَتْ عَنْهُ مِائَةُ سَيِّئَةٍ، وَكَانَتْ لَهُ حِرْزًا مِنَ الشَّيْطَانِ يَوْمَهُ ذَلِكَ حَتَّى يُمْسِيَ، وَلَمْ يَأْتِ أَحَدٌ (٣) أَفْضَلَ مِمَّا جَاءَ بِهِ، إِلَّا امْرُؤٌ عَمِلَ أَكْثَرَ مِنْ ذَلِكَ،، ، وَمَنْ قَالَ فِي يَوْمٍ: سُبْحَانَ اللهِ وَبِحَمْدِهِ مِائَةَ مَرَّةٍ، حُطَّتْ (١) خَطَايَاهُ، وَإِنْ كَانَتْ مِثْلَ زَبَدِ الْبَحْرِ " (٢)،
Translation
English translation
It is narrated from Abu Huraira (may Allah be pleased with him) that the Noble Prophet (ﷺ) said: Whoever recites these words three times during the day: "La ilaha illallah wahdahu la sharika lahu, lahul mulk wa lahul hamd wa huwa ‘ala kulli shay’in qadeer," it will be equal to freeing ten slaves, and a hundred good deeds will be written for him, a hundred sins will be erased, and until the evening, it will be a means of protection from Satan for him. And no one will be able to present a deed superior to this except the one who does more than this. And the Noble Prophet (ﷺ) said: Whoever recites "Subhanallahi wa bihamdihi" a hundred times during the day, all his sins will be erased, even if they are as much as the foam of the sea.
